She founded the order of the missionaries of charity, a roman catholic congregation of women dedicated to the poor, and she was canonized as a saint in 2016.

On october 7, 1950, mother teresa received permission from the holy see to start her own order, “the missionaries of charity”, whose primary task was to love and care for those persons nobody was prepared to look after.
